XR strategy requires more than building a game

Between February and March 2021, Accenture Research conducted a global survey of 306 senior executives in five countries (China, France, Germany, United Kingdom and United States) to understand their organization’s investment in and use of extended reality technologies for workplace training. Respondents represented more than 12 industries from companies $1 billion or more in global revenue.


An important outcome:

With a vision and strategy in place, the steps to achieving sufficient business integration (scope), workforce reach (scale) and future flexibility (agility) depend on making key decisions across four areas—infrastructure, hardware, ecosystem, and people. Since these are cross-functional decisions that impact the entire enterprise, it is important that CHROs/Learning & Development function and CTOs/IT function collaborate closely throughout the journey.
